Under severe operating conditions inspection should be more frequently; detected defects should be
repaired promptly. Severe operating conditions can be defined as:
•
Application temperature less or above than specified on the valve tag label
•
Flow velocity higher than 5 m/sec for liquids, and 200 m/sec for gaseous
•
Acidic media PH < 5 or alkaline media PH > 9
Habonim recommend a proof test interval of 12 months; in case of Fail to Open ESD system, a partial stroke
is acceptable to confirm that the installation is functioning properly.
For ESD systems with a Fail-To-Close demand, it is necessary to plan a system shut-down; de-energize the
system and inspect the valve turning to its fully closed position.
It is essential to log-in the following parameters on site QA records
as a proof for preserving SIL capabilities: date, hour, name and signature of the responsible engineer, air
pressure on site, time to close the valve, time to open the valve.
Habonim recommend valve full maintenance operation every 500,000 cycles or 4 years, whichever comes
first. The combined corrosion and erosion allowance for the valve body wall thickness is 1 mm. When this
allowance has been eroded or corroded, mechanically removed or otherwise, the valve should no longer be
used. Inspect the valve wall thickness every time the valve is maintained.
The estimated mean time to repair (MTTR) a valve, i.e. time net (line draining or cooling down time excluded
from the valve MTTR) of replacing old valve with a new one is 60 minutes. Maintenance team must read and
understand the Habonim product IOM before starting the operation. In case of a doubt please consult the
Habonim engineering team.
When a valve has been repaired or any maintenance was performed, check the valve for proper function
(proof testing). Any failures affecting functional safety should be reported to the Habonim factory.
Client should consult the Habonim factory in order to obtain the product assessment, FMEDA report,
and other associated statistical data to satisfy SIL level.
The ambient temperature range for which these valves are suitable depends on the materials used in
their construction and the pressure at which they will be used. The maximum withstand temperature
is included in the Pressure Equipment Directive (PED) marking. The lower ambient will be specified in
the documentation provided with each valve.
